Half-Time Report: Callum Wilson overhead kick gives Bournemouth lead over Leicester City

A Callum Wilson over-head kick gives Bournemouth a 1-0 half-time lead over Leicester City this afternoon.

Leicester made a lively start to the first half, as N'Golo Kante missed an early half-chance from close range.

Riyad Mahrez thought he had given the visitors the lead on seven minutes after rounding Artur Boruc, but the Algerian was flagged offside.

The Foxes again came close to taking the lead after Danny Drinkwater found Jamie Vardy in the box, but the England international curled a shot over.

Claudio Ranieri's side had settled into the game, but it was Bournemouth who took the lead against the run of play on 24 minutes through a Wilson scissor kick.

The Cherries took control of the game following Wilson's opener, and Max Gradel came close to doubling their advantage when his free kick was punched away by Kasper Schmeichel.
